Factors to Consider When Choosing Crypto Investments

Before diving into the top picks, let’s discuss what makes a cryptocurrency worth investing in:

  1. Market Capitalization and Adoption: A higher market cap often signals stability and widespread adoption. Coins like Bitcoin and Ethereum dominate in this category.
  2. Utility and Use Cases: Projects with real-world applications, such as DeFi or NFTs, offer long-term potential.
  3. Development Activity: An active developer community and continuous updates reflect a robust and evolving ecosystem.
  4. Regulatory Compliance: Coins that demonstrate efforts to comply with regulations are less likely to face legal obstacles.

1. Bitcoin (BTC)

As the pioneer of cryptocurrencies, Bitcoin remains the gold standard. It’s widely recognized as a digital store of value, often referred to as “digital gold.” Institutional investors like Tesla and MicroStrategy have fueled its mainstream adoption, and with a capped supply of 21 million coins, Bitcoin’s scarcity model continues to drive its value. 2. Ethereum (ETH)

Ethereum is the backbone of decentralized applications (dApps), smart contracts, and the DeFi ecosystem. With the Ethereum 2.0 upgrade, the network transitioned to Proof of Stake (PoS), improving scalability, speed, and energy efficiency. Ethereum dominates the NFT market and powers many Web3 innovations, positioning it for substantial growth by 2025.


3. Binance Coin (BNB)

BNB is the native token of Binance, the world’s largest cryptocurrency exchange. Its utility spans trading fee discounts, staking, and token burns, driving demand. The Binance Smart Chain (BSC) has become a hub for affordable DeFi and NFT projects, further solidifying BNB’s role in the crypto ecosystem.


4. Cardano (ADA)

Known for its academic rigor and sustainability, Cardano is a blockchain designed for scalability and interoperability. Recent upgrades, such as smart contract functionality, enable ADA to compete in DeFi and NFTs. Its partnerships with governments (cardano governance model) and academic institutions highlight its long-term potential.


5. Solana (SOL)

Solana is famous for its lightning-fast transaction speeds and low fees. It has become a favorite for NFT projects, gaming platforms, and DeFi applications. Strong developer activity and an expanding ecosystem make SOL a promising investment for the future.

Solana has become very famous in the last period because of the big meme coins launched on its chain.


6. Polkadot (DOT)

Polkadot aims to connect multiple blockchains, enabling seamless data sharing and interoperability. Its unique parachain technology allows developers to create custom blockchains tailored to specific use cases. DOT is positioned as a cornerstone of Web3 infrastructure, making it a key player to watch.


7. Avalanche (AVAX)

Avalanche boasts one of the fastest transaction finality times in the blockchain space. Its focus on scalability and energy efficiency has attracted numerous DeFi and enterprise applications. As its ecosystem grows, AVAX continues to gain traction as a top-tier blockchain.

9. Polygon (MATIC)

Polygon is a Layer-2 scaling solution for Ethereum, addressing its high gas fees and scalability issues. By enabling faster and cheaper transactions, Polygon has attracted major DeFi projects and Web3 developers. With ongoing integrations, MATIC remains a strong contender for 2025.


10. XRP (XRP)

XRP focuses on revolutionizing cross-border payments, offering speed and cost efficiency. Ripple, the company behind XRP, has secured numerous partnerships with financial institutions.

How to Diversify Your Crypto Portfolio

Diversification is critical in managing risk and optimizing returns. Here’s how to do it effectively:

  1. Balance Large-Cap and Emerging Coins: Include stable assets like Bitcoin and Ethereum while exploring smaller projects like Avalanche or Polygon for higher growth potential.
  2. Use Portfolio Management Tools: Platforms like CoinStats or Delta help track performance across multiple assets.
  3. Monitor Trends: Stay updated on developments to adjust your portfolio as needed.

Risks and Challenges in Crypto Investments

While crypto investments offer lucrative opportunities, they come with risks:

  1. Volatility: Prices can fluctuate wildly, affecting short-term investments.
  2. Regulatory Uncertainty: Changes in laws can impact the adoption and value of cryptocurrencies.
  3. Security: Always store your assets in secure wallets like hardware wallets and use two-factor authentication to prevent hacks.
